Error 734  

Error 734 The PPP Link Control Protocol Was Terminated
If you try to establish a dial-up connection, you may receive the following error message: Error 734: The PPP link control protocol was terminated. As a result, you cannot establish a dial-up connection.
The information in this article applies to: Microsoft Windows 2000 Professional, Microsoft Windows XP, Microsoft Windows Server 2003, Standard Edition Microsoft Windows Server 2003, Enterprise Edition, Microsoft Windows Server 2003, and Datacenter Edition.
To resolve this issue:
1. Click Start, point to Settings, and then click Network and Dial-up Connections.
NOTE: For Windows Server 2003, click Start, point to Control Panel, and then point to Network Connections.
 
2. Right-click the appropriate dial-up networking connection, and then click Properties.
 
3. Click the Networking tab, and then click Settings.
 
4. Click to clear the Negotiate multi-link for single link connections check box (if it is selected).
 
5. Click OK, and then click OK.
 
6. Double-click the connection, and then click Dial.
 
If this procedure resolves the issue and you can establish a dial-up connection, you do not have to follow the remaining steps in this article. If this does not resolve the issue and you cannot establish a dial-up connection, go to step 7 to continue to troubleshoot this issue.
 
7. Right-click the connection, and then click Properties.
 
8. Click the Security tab.
 
9. Under Security options, click Allow unsecured password in the Validate my identity as follows box, and then click OK.
 
10. Double-click the connection, and then click Dial to verify that you can establish a dial-up connection.
